case distinction if OS is Darwin based, gitignore

Mac hat ohne homebrew coreutils scheinbar kein korrektes readlink und
mag den Parameter -e nicht, deshalb wird der weggelassen.
Noch ein paar Files die hier nicht reingehoeren entfernt.

Change-Id: Ifc4f55132a28b66efa8d80ebdf9131f51200ffdf
diff --git a/.gitignore b/.gitignore
index c75dc7c..9af57db 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1 +1,4 @@
 logs/*
+HEADERFILES
+CODEFILES
+LPCFILES